Abstract

Vascular cognitive impairment (VCI) is the initial stage of vascular dementia (VaD). Early diagnosis and treatment of VCI are crucial to prevent the progression of VaD. In order to gain a better understanding of VCI, this study aimed to investigate the use of advanced imaging techniques such as structural magnetic resonance imaging (sMRI) and resting-state functional magnetic resonance imaging (rs-fMRI). These techniques allow researchers to observe the structural and functional changes in the brain that are associated with VCI. Functional magnetic resonance imaging (fMRI) and sMRI techniques have been widely used in studies focusing on gray matter, brain networks, and functional abnormalities during rest. By searching and summarizing recent literature, this study has provided valuable evidence on the use of advanced imaging techniques in understanding and treating VCI. The findings from this study can aid in the development of early intervention strategies for patients with VCI, potentially slowing down or even halting the progression of VCI to full-blown VaD.
